já existem tutoriais para isso.
verifique este aqui:
Eu tenho o Ubuntu 13.04 no meu laptop. Eu preciso instalar o cocos2dx nele. Alguém sabe como instalá-lo?
Por favor, explique como instalar.
Ubuntu 17.04
Depois de / se meus dois patches abaixo forem mesclados, o uso será trivial:
git clone --recursive https://github.com/cocos2d/cocos2d-x
cd cocos2d-x
git checkout 7350aeca8cf2c5bea3c3484d50202bf13cc18041
./build/install-deps-linux.sh
./download-deps.py
mkdir build-make
cd build-make
cmake ..
make -j'nproc'
./bin/cpp-tests/cpp-tests
Antes da mesclagem, basta copiar e colar
os arquivos modificados de cocos2d-x-3rd-party-libs-bin
a external/
:
install-deps-linux.sh
altera suas alternativas de atualização gcc e g ++ ... mas todas compilam bem com a versão padrão do GCC no Ubuntu 17.04, e parecem existir apenas para melhorar o GCC do Travis de 4.8 para 4.9 ...
Então, comente as linhas link ou, depois de executar o script,
sudo update-alternatives --remove-all gcc
sudo update-alternatives --remove-all g++
sudo update-alternatives --install /usr/bin/gcc gcc "/usr/bin/gcc-6" 10
sudo update-alternatives --install /usr/bin/g++ g++ "/usr/bin/g++-$v" 10